The Indian stock market witnessed a sharp decline on Tuesday, June 23, 2026, mirroring weakness across global markets. The NIFTY 50 closed at 23,824.10, down 278.80 points or 1.16%, as heavy selling in information technology stocks weighed on the benchmark indices.

A global retreat in technology stocks triggered weakness in domestic IT shares, amplifying downside pressure. Additionally, a stronger US dollar impacted metal stocks, while profit booking in PSU counters further contributed to the overall decline.

NIFTY 50 Performance Overview

The benchmark index opened lower and extended its losses throughout the session. Investor sentiment remained weak as global cues turned negative, particularly in the technology sector.

Selling pressure intensified due to concerns over currency movements and a weakening global demand outlook. Despite some support from defensive stocks, the index remained firmly in negative territory for most of the trading day.

SectorWise Market Movement

The information technology sector was the biggest drag on the market, led by sharp declines in Infosys, Wipro and Tata Consultancy Services. Metal stocks also faced pressure due to a stronger US dollar, impacting companies like JSW Steel.

PSU and infrastructure names saw profit booking, adding to overall weakness. In contrast, pharmaceutical stocks provided defensive support, with Cipla and Dr Reddy’s posting gains and limiting the index’s downside.
